Negotiating Pricing and Lead Times with Ute Tray Canopy Manufacturers
Effective negotiations with ute tray canopy manufacturers require thorough preparation and understanding of market dynamics that influence pricing structures. Volume-based pricing typically begins at minimum order quantities of 50-100 units, with significant discounts available for orders exceeding 500 units. Professional buyers should request detailed cost breakdowns that separate material costs, manufacturing expenses, and shipping charges to identify potential savings opportunities. Lead time negotiations become critical when planning seasonal inventory or meeting specific project deadlines, as manufacturers often require 15-30 days for standard production runs and up to 45 days for customized specifications. Establishing framework agreements with multiple suppliers provides leverage during negotiations while ensuring backup options for urgent requirements. Payment terms significantly impact overall procurement costs, with manufacturers typically offering 2-4% discounts for upfront payments or letters of credit, compared to standard 30-60 day payment cycles. Successful negotiators focus on building long-term partnerships that benefit both parties, emphasizing consistent order volumes and reliable payment schedules that justify preferential pricing and priority production scheduling.
Planning Logistics and Shipping: Insights for Importing Truck Canopy in Volume
International shipping logistics for truck canopy imports require careful coordination of multiple transportation modes and regulatory requirements. Container optimization becomes crucial when importing aluminum canopies, as standard 40-foot containers can accommodate 80-120 units depending on size configurations and packaging efficiency. Professional logistics coordinators work closely with freight forwarders to determine optimal shipping routes that balance cost and transit time, considering factors such as port congestion, seasonal weather patterns, and customs processing delays. Documentation requirements include commercial invoices, packing lists, bills of lading, and certificates of origin, with accurate product classifications ensuring smooth customs clearance. Insurance considerations become particularly important for high-value shipments, with comprehensive coverage protecting against damage, theft, and delay-related losses. Warehousing arrangements should be confirmed prior to shipment arrival, ensuring adequate space and handling equipment for container unloading and inventory distribution. Professional importers maintain relationships with customs brokers who understand specific product requirements and can expedite clearance processes while ensuring compliance with all regulatory standards.
Ensuring Quality Control and Compliance When Ordering from Truck Bed Canopy Manufacturers Overseas
Quality assurance for overseas truck bed canopy manufacturers involves systematic inspections to verify product specifications before shipment. Third-party services provide independent checks of manufacturing standards, materials, and finish quality, with reports on dimensional accuracy, surface treatments, and hardware functionality. Compliance varies by market, with safety certifications, environmental standards, and labeling requirements potentially affecting acceptance and resale. Quality control programs set clear criteria for material tolerances, surface finishes, and hardware performance. New suppliers or modified specifications should undergo sample approval, with pre-production samples verified against drawings and standards. Factory audits assess manufacturing capabilities, quality systems, and production capacity, helping buyers gauge supplier reliability. Documentation such as material certificates, test reports, and inspections supports warranty claims and regulatory compliance. Effective quality control includes ongoing monitoring, customer feedback analysis, and corrective actions to maintain consistent quality across production runs.
